Abstract
Evolution of Ni3Al phase in a nickel-base directionally solidified superalloy has been investigated during creep rupture testing (1253 K/150 MPa). Besides the splitting, rafting and Ostwald ripening cases, many finer Ni3Al particles have been firstly observed to precipitate from the rafted Ni3Al particles. A simple qualitative interpretation has been proposed.
